Uber Eats operations to be closed down in Ukraine early in June

However, the company plans to continue its core rides business.

Uber Technologies Inc. says it has decided to close down its Uber Eats operations in Ukraine from June 3.

"After extensive cooperation with local restaurants to provide convenient and reliable food delivery, we have made an uneasy decision to halt Uber Eats services in Ukraine from Wednesday, June 3," the company's press service said in a statement on May 4.

The company says it is very upset over Uber Eats to be discontinued in Ukraine, but plans to continue its core rides business.

"First of all, we are now trying to minimize the possible negative consequences of this decision for our highly valued employees, restaurants and courier partners, as well as customers whose support we had," the press service said.

The company also thanked all fans of Uber Eats in Ukraine – from partners to customers – for their support.

UNIAN memo. The Uber Eats international food delivery service launched its operations in Ukraine on February 6, 2019. Kyiv was the first Ukrainian city to host Uber Eats. Uber Taxi became available in Ukraine on June 30, 2016. Kyiv was also the first Ukrainian city where this service was launched.
